Ordinals
alpha
Address bc1qtdzr64p3glylsq0rjcwccnyeast95c7ys7gwux
sat balance
25000000
runes balances
outputs
676600c804f91beb390e2bc449905e7d79a61a408a19c778aa79f43be9e4b3cf:31